I have it and really like it, the stories good too. Like others have said the 3D is very good, I especially like it when the vagabond gets chased on the roof of the train.

I had viewed the movie with the old "red/blue" plastic glasses, which was very poor 3D, so I didnt hold much hope. This is So much better.

hmmm. you're not here ummm... advertising are you, visualworldproducts?

And for the record pretty much any reald, vizio, LG, generics work in theaters and on passive tvs.
And XPands will work with many active tv's and some movie theaters.
